'Precautionary' Evacuation at Kerrydale Elementary

Students and staff are safe.

 

Update 12:54 p.m.:

From PWCS: "Kerrydale Elementary School students and staff are safe and have re-entered the school following earlier evacuation. The Fire Department has given the all clear to end the precautionary evacuation after a thorough check. All summer school activities resuming (10:59 a.m.)."

Original Post: 

Prince Wiliam County Schools announced Wednesday morning that Kerrydale Elementary School was evacuated as a precaution.

PWCS said the smell of smoke prompted the evacuation.

"All students and staff are safe. The Fire Department is investigating. Stay tuned for further messages as the situation is evaluated," the school system posted on its Facebook page at 10:37 a.m. 

Kerrydale Elementary School in Dale City is a location for site-based summer school that started on July 9.
